When Mercury in Cancer forms a quincunx aspect with Ceres in Sagittarius in a composite chart, it suggests a subtle yet complex dynamic within the relationship centered around communication and care. Mercury in Cancer indicates that your communication style is emotionally driven, nurturing, and often protective. There's a strong inclination towards discussing feelings, past experiences, and creating a sense of emotional security through words. Ceres in Sagittarius, however, brings a different flavor to nurturing. It is about growth through exploration, adventure, and the sharing of wisdom. The quincunx aspect can create a sense of misalignment as you try to find common ground between the emotional security sought by Mercury in Cancer and the expansive nurturing philosophy of Ceres in Sagittarius.
This aspect requires adjustments and a willingness to stretch beyond comfort zones. You might find yourselves attempting to merge the Cancerian need for closeness and intimacy with the Sagittarian desire for freedom and learning. This can lead to a scenario where one of you craves deep, heartfelt conversations while the other yearns for experiences that broaden the mind and spirit. It's a dance between holding on and letting go, between the familiar and the foreign. The challenge lies in honoring both these needs without sacrificing one for the other. This might manifest in discussions that oscillate between deep emotional revelations and debates on philosophical or cultural issues, with each of you taking turns to lead and follow.
Navigating this quincunx asks for patience and a willingness to embrace the unconventional nature of your relationship. It's about learning to express care in ways that are both emotionally resonant and intellectually stimulating. The key is to realize that the emotional depth and the quest for knowledge can complement each other, leading to a richer, more rounded form of mutual support. This can be achieved through conscious efforts to integrate the two, perhaps by planning travel that feels like a nurturing retreat, or engaging in learning experiences that also cater to emotional bonding.
